secure android tabletSecure your tablet, just like a computer or a smartphone, well. After all, you don’t want others to have access to your personal photos and data.

We don’t know any better with a computer, but with a tablet, good security sometimes falls short. While a tablet often contains all kinds of important data, private photos and personal files. Even if you usually use the tablet at home, it is still wise to opt for different protections. Be ahead of thieves and snoopers.

To prevent anyone from being able to unlock your tablet just like that, it is wise to set a lock. With many tablets, it is standard that only a swipe is needed. But rather use a pin code, pattern, or even better: a password. The more characters, and the more variety in numbers, characters, and letters, the better.

How to change the password or unlock form:

  • Open the Settings.
  • Tap on lock screen.
  • Tap on Screen lock type.
  • Now choose one of the options.

Android regularly releases new updates. In addition to new features, it also contains improvements and security updates. Vulnerabilities found are also addressed. So it is wise to always download the latest update. Then you can be sure that your security is up-to-date.

This way you can check whether the operating system needs to be updated.

  • Open the Settings.
  • Tap on software update.
  • Tap on Download and install.
  • If it says ‘Your software is up to date’, you don’t need to do anything. If an update is available, tap Install now. The installation starts immediately, this can take quite some time.

Another way to keep the tablet safe is to only download apps from the Play Store. These apps are all checked by Google and therefore safe. So don’t just follow a link to another place on the internet to download something there. You then know less well what you are getting. But if you download an app from the Play Store, take a critical look at the permissions that the app asks for. Want a game access to your contacts and the ability to record sound? Skip that app and look forward to a game that only asks for what is needed.

In addition, it is also important for apps to update regularly. The app developers regularly tighten security. To check for an update for your apps:

  • Open the Play Store.
  • Tap the three horizontal bars at the top left.
  • Tap on My apps and games.

Here is an overview of apps that can be updated and apps that have recently been updated.

  • Tap on Update all. If it isn’t there, everything is already up to date.

In addition, pay attention to the following:

  • Be alert to phishing and never open attachments of an email that you do not fully trust. A virus could also end up on the tablet.
  • Make regular backups. If you lose the tablet, you still have (part of) your files available. Read more about that in the article ‘Backing up on Android devices’.
